Petrochemical industry becomes most profitable in China

China's petrochemical industry, with profits of 159.8 billion yuan (US$19.3 billion) from January to November, has become the most profitable industry in China, according to figures from the State Development and Reform Commission.

China's petrochemical industry, with profits of 159.8 billion yuan (US$19.3 billion) from January to November, has become the most profitable industry in China, according to figures from the State Development and Reform Commission.

The petrochemical industry, followed by the machine, light industry, power and metallurgical industry in profits rankings, increased profits by 50.2 billion yuan over the same period last year.

The profits of the machine industry totaled 135.3 billion yuan, 50.7 per cent of which was contributed by China's booming auto industry.

Light industry realized profits of 106.4 billion yuan, and the power industry 63.2 billion yuan.

China, as the first country to produce over 200 million tons of steel annually, also saw metallurgical industry profits soar to 59. 3 billion yuan in the first 11 months, up 31.4 billion yuan from the same period last year.
